IP查询
查询
你查询的IP:[122.8.95.245] 地理位置:中国–上海–上海
最新查询
119.58.94.77
121.60.62.68
125.112.108.174
117.72.74.64
220.252.2.28
211.64.5.113
125.96.60.10
123.52.202.210
118.84.87.20
122.8.95.245
221.136.154.53
119.148.160.97
203.135.160.165
116.13.216.97
122.119.176.56
121.56.29.136
203.100.32.1
61.29.128.234
202.43.144.107
118.24.251.60
202.127.22.205
123.128.189.185
117.103.16.166
124.68.14.71
119.19.2.231
119.28.32.128
203.134.240.6
210.82.255.148
117.121.192.187
202.46.32.127
222.176.174.81